We are in the midst of Cannes Film Festival, one of the most important international cinema festivals, and we wish to let you know which, in our opinion are the most anticipated movies:
Dogman: is a film directed by Matteo Garrone that narrates the crime news that upset Rome in the late 80’s: the history of the “canaro”.
The movie is set in the Rome district of Magliana, depicted as a wild industrial far west. From the beginning of the first trailer, you will immediately recognize the harsh reality Garrone loves to depict.

Cold War: is a film by Pawl Pawlikowski (known for Ida, which won the best foreign film Oscar in 2015) narrates a complicated love story during the Polish’s reconstruction after WW2. The movie is beautifully enriched by a superb black and white and conveys isolation and poetry.
